Laser diode bar modules on heat sinks are high-power semiconductor laser devices that consist of multiple laser diode chips integrated into a single package mounted on a heat sink. A high quality laser diode heat sink, also referred to as a mount, is typically constructed from anodized aluminum, copper or nickel plated copper. The mounting or heatsinking of the laser package is of tremendous importance because operating temperature strongly influences laser lifetime and performance. Laser diodes form a subset of the larger classification of semiconductor p – n junction diodes. Forward electrical bias across the laser diode causes the two species of charge carrier – holes and electrons – to be injected from opposite sides of the PIN junction into the depletion region.
